Risk Management and Responsible Gaming

A crucial aspect often incorporated into services like ringospin, is a focus on responsible gaming and effective risk management. The potential for financial losses is inherent in many forms of online gaming, and it’s vital that players approach the activity with a level head and a clear understanding of their limits. These platforms often provide tools and resources to help players manage their spending, set limits on their playtime, and identify potential warning signs of problem gambling. Promoting responsible gaming isn’t just a matter of ethical obligation; it’s also in the best interest of the platform and its users, fostering a sustainable and enjoyable gaming environment for everyone.

Setting Limits and Self-Exclusion Options

One of the most important features in this area is the ability to set limits on deposits, wagers, and playtime. Players can specify a maximum amount of money they’re willing to spend within a given timeframe, or a maximum amount of time they’ll spend playing. These limits serve as a safeguard, preventing players from exceeding their self-imposed boundaries. Furthermore, many platforms offer self-exclusion options, allowing players to temporarily or permanently ban themselves from accessing the service. This is a valuable tool for individuals who are struggling with problem gambling, providing them with an escape from temptation and a chance to regain control.

  1. Set a budget before you start playing.
  2. Stick to your pre-defined limits.
  3. Take frequent breaks.
  4. Never chase your losses.
  5. Recognize the signs of problem gambling.

Adhering to these simple guidelines is essential for ensuring a positive and responsible gaming experience. This proactive approach helps safeguard against potential financial and emotional harm.
